What is required for ensuring that each object in an object type is unique?

Prepare for the Palantir Application Developer Test. Engage with flashcards and multiple choice questions, each with detailed explanations. Ace your exam with confidence!

In the context of database design and object-oriented programming, ensuring that each object within an object type is unique typically relies on the concept of a primary key. A primary key is a specific attribute (or a combination of attributes) that uniquely identifies each record in a database table or each object in an object-oriented database.

When a primary key is defined for an object type, it guarantees that no two objects can have the same value for that key, effectively making each object distinct. This is crucial for maintaining data integrity, as it prevents duplication and allows for reliable retrieval and manipulation of data.

While other elements such as property types, foreign keys, and join tables play important roles in data management and relationships between tables, they do not directly serve to ensure uniqueness for individual objects in the same way that a primary key does. For instance, a foreign key relates one table to another and is used to maintain referential integrity, while a join table is used to create many-to-many relationships. However, neither of these guarantees the uniqueness of an individual object.

In summary, the primary key is the essential tool used to ensure that each object in an object type is unique, thereby maintaining the structure and integrity of the data.

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y